Discovery Zone is the experimental pop project of New York musician and multimedia artist JJ Weihl. After the slow-building but undeniable fervor around her debut album Remote Control, Discovery Zone released her second album Quantum Web on RVNG Intl. and Mansions and Millions in 2024, followed by an expanded version in 2025. On Quantum Web, Discovery Zone plunged into an uncanny valley, where the distinctions between the earnest and the ironic blur in tandem with the human and the post-human. 

On her new album Library Copy Do Not Remove, Weihl presents a digital enchantment of reality, braiding together the material and non-material to reveal that they are, in fact, two aspects of one and the same thing. In Weihl’s world, Nature and technology are not enemies, but instead create each other in an infinite dance of meaning and reflection.

On stage, Discovery Zone explores a widescreen pop sound speckled with luminous vocal performances and baroque instrumental flourishes. She utilizes a laboratory of instruments and 3D visuals to explore the universe as a source of information.
